排气管中二维非定常流动的试验研究

摘    要:以MPC二维排气管模型为对象,对其二维非定常流动进行了研究。在柴油机倒拖时,测量了该模型排气管内6个截面的压力和速度分布的变化,研究了热线探头标定前的预处理、实测状态与标定状态差异引起的误差修正和流动方向判别对速度测量的影响。测量结果显示,同一截面不同测点的压力变化曲线非常接近;支管的速度分布曲线是不对称的,其峰值偏向支管的内壁面,进入总管后速度曲线呈偏向总管外壁面的不对称分布,随后渐渐变为对称分布。测量结果还可用于排气管二维非定常流动计算的边界条件和考核数据。

Experimental Investigation on Two-Dimensional Unsteady Gas Flow in an Exhaust Manifold

Abstract:The gas flow in exhaust manifolds has much effect on scavenge,pumping loss and exhaust energy utilization of turbocharged diesel engines.This paper presents experimental investigation on two-dimensional usteady flow in MPC exhaust manifold model.The pressure and velocity distributions in six sections of the manifold model were measured when the diesel engine was motored.Effect of probe contamination,circumstance difference between measurement and calibration and flow direction differentiation on velocity measurement by HWA were studied.The experimental results show that velocity distributions vary with place and time,and the pressure traces at different points of the same section were not different obviously.
